About The Position

Douron’s summer internship program is designed to mutually benefit those seeking experience and the company seeking additional help during its busy season. Interns may be placed in varying departments depending on a combination of business needs and the intern’s desired area of experience. The employment is seasonal and includes predetermined start and end dates.
